Folly Farm Holiday Park – Five-Star Family Escapes in Pembrokeshire
Folly Farm Holiday Park is an award-winning, five-star destination set across 100 acres of rolling Pembrokeshire countryside. Perfectly positioned just ten minutes from Saundersfoot and fifteen minutes from Tenby, this unique holiday park combines luxurious accommodation with unlimited access to one of Wales’ most beloved family attractions.
Nestled beside Folly Farm’s very own zoo, working farm, vintage fairground, and adventure play zones, the park offers a one-of-a-kind getaway. Guests staying in lodges or holiday cottages enjoy unlimited free entry to all attractions during opening hours. Those choosing glamping, camping, or touring need only pay once for admission and can return as often as they like throughout their stay.
Accommodation Options
All accommodation is finished to an exceptional standard and includes crisp bedlinen, fluffy towels, Wi-Fi, smart TVs, and fully equipped kitchens.
Simba Lodges
Named UK Accommodation of the Year, the lion-themed Simba Lodges sleep six in style. Each lodge offers a vaulted open-plan living space that opens onto a wide deck overlooking the animal paddocks. The master suite includes a king-size bed and en-suite shower, while two twin rooms share a family bathroom. Floor-to-ceiling windows provide sunrise views over the zoo, and guests may even hear the lions’ evening roar.
Kifaru Lodges
Rhino-inspired Kifaru Lodges blend bold design with comfort. Accommodating six guests, they include a double bedroom, twin, and bunk room, alongside two sleek bathrooms. A bright lounge with underfloor heating and French doors leads to a private veranda, where guests can watch endangered black rhinos roam nearby.
Balwen & Torwen Lodges
Inspired by Welsh rare-breed sheep, Balwen and Torwen Lodges bring rustic charm to the countryside. Sleeping six, they feature timber cladding, wool throws, and muted tones. A spacious kitchen-diner is perfect for family meals, and children love the tractor-themed bunk beds. Outside, a fenced lawn provides a safe space to play.
Fairground Lodges
Full of vintage flair, the Fairground Lodges come in two- or three-bedroom configurations, sleeping four or six. Each features accessible layouts, vibrant decor, an accessible shower room, and a level deck with picnic table. Pet-friendly and deluxe options are available, while an adapted lodge includes wider doorways and a roll-in wet-room.
Folly View Farmhouse
Ideal for extended families or group holidays, Folly View accommodates ten guests across five bedrooms. The vast open-plan lounge features a bespoke cuddle chair themed around Lily the Suffolk Punch horse. French doors open onto a wrap-around terrace with views over the paddocks and Preseli Hills. Two doubles include en-suites, while pig and tractor-themed twin rooms share a family bathroom. Additional features include a utility room, boot store, and generous parking.
Twiga Safari Tents
For glamping with a twist, the giraffe-themed Twiga Safari Tents sleep six beneath canvas and timber. They include real beds, a full bathroom, kitchen, and a wood-burning stove. A covered balcony furnished with safari chairs offers a perfect spot for stargazing or listening to the lemurs at dawn.
Showman’s Wagons
Step back in time with the colourful Showman’s Wagons, lovingly restored to blend vintage fairground charm with modern convenience. Sleeping four in two bedrooms, each wagon features pine interiors, quirky décor, central heating, a compact kitchen, and shower room. Outside seating provides a front-row view of the vintage Big Wheel.

Explore Pembrokeshire and Beyond
Folly Farm Holiday Park is a gateway to the Pembrokeshire Coast National Park, home to 186 miles of coastal path, 52 beaches, and incredible wildlife. Families can enjoy beach days at Saundersfoot, kayaking from Tenby’s postcard-perfect harbour, or historic outings to Castell Henllys.
Outdoor enthusiasts can cycle the nearby Brunel Trail or hike up Carn Ingli for sweeping views. Popular attractions include Carew Castle, Blue Lagoon Waterpark, and boat trips to see puffins on Skomer Island.
Back on site, guests enjoy nearly 100 animal species at the zoo, classic fun at the vintage fairground, and engaging activities in the barn and indoor play zones—all included or heavily discounted for holiday park guests.
